Costa Rica is making moves to step up the tourism.
The tourism board just announced that Costa Rica will start accepting cruise ships in September. The ships will only allow vaccinated passengers to board.
As of July 2nd, American Airlines increased flights to San Jose (SJO) from Miami.
Also in the works is a Digital Nomads Bill. This one really gets me excited. Once passed, it will allow travelers that work online to stay in the country for a year, with the option of applying for another year. If this bill passes it will be just like granting residency to anyone who works online. It will allow the tourists to drive with their own countries license as well as other benefits.
Fun Fact; More than 270,000 people have arrived in Costa Rica from the United States over the first five months of 2021.
